Product Detailed Parameters
- Description:IC MCU 8BIT 8KB FLASH 20QFN
- Series:tinyAVR™ 1, Functional Safety (FuSa)
- Mfr:Microchip Technology
- Package:Tray
- Core Processor:AVR
- Core Size:8-Bit
- Speed:16MHz
- Connectivity:I2C, IrDA, LINbus, SPI, UART/USART
- Peripherals:Brown-out Detect/Reset, POR, WDT
- Number of I/O:18
- Program Memory Size:8KB (8K x 8)
- Program Memory Type:FLASH
- EEPROM Size:128 x 8
- RAM Size:512 x 8
- Voltage - Supply (Vcc/Vdd):2.7V ~ 5.5V
- Data Converters:A/D 12x10b; D/A 1x8b
- Oscillator Type:Internal
- Operating Temperature:-40°C ~ 125°C (TA)
- Mounting Type:Surface Mount
- Supplier Device Package:20-VQFN (3x3)
- Package / Case:20-VFQFN Exposed Pad

Overview
The ATTINY816-MF is an 8-bit AVR microcontroller from Microchip Technology's tinyAVR 1 series, designed with functional safety (FuSa) capabilities. It features a maximum clock frequency of 16MHz and includes 8KB of flash memory. The device operates within a voltage range of 1.8V to 5.5V and utilizes a 20-VQFN package measuring 3x3mm.
